NES 파일 형식은 일반적으로 '.nes' 확장자를 사용하며, 닌텐도 엔터테인먼트 시스템(NES) 게임의 프로그램 코드와 데이터를 포함하는 ROM 이미지 파일입니다. 이 파일들은 기본적으로 게임 카트리지의 전체 복사본으로, 사용자가 에뮬레이터를 통해 고전 NES 게임을 PC나 모바일 기기에서 플레이할 수 있게 해줍니다. NES 형식은 비교적 단순한 구조를 가지고 있으며, 파일 헤더(Header)와 그 뒤를 잇는 프로그램 ROM(PRG-ROM) 및 캐릭터 ROM(CHR-ROM)으로 구성됩니다. 헤더에는 매퍼(Mapper) 번호, ROM 및 CHR-ROM의 크기, 그리고 게임이 수직 또는 수평 미러링을 사용하는지 여부와 같은 중요한 메타데이터가 포함되어 있습니다. 에뮬레이터는 이 정보를 참조하여 게임을 하드웨어 환경에 맞게 정확히 로드하고 실행합니다. NES의 오랜 역사와 높은 대중성 덕분에 현재 온라인상에는 방대한 양의 NES ROM 라이브러리가 존재하지만, 이러한 파일의 무단 배포 및 공유는 저작권법의 보호를 받으므로 주의가 필요합니다. NES 형식은 현대 레트로 게임 문화의 핵심적인 요소로 자리 잡았으며, 전 세계의 수많은 매니아들에 의해 여전히 활발하게 이용되고 있습니다. 또한 파일 구조의 단순함 덕분에 공식 게임뿐만 아니라 개인 개발자들이 제작하는 홈브류(Homebrew) 게임 개발 분야에서도 널리 활용되는 표준 형식입니다.